Transaction 67650d51a73164a5d4314da262f6a3fe40b9f1d50cc92a34bb1eacab9b9bb15d

1 Input
2 Outputs
  • 67650d51a73164a5d4314da262f6a3fe40b9f1d50cc92a34bb1eacab9b9bb15d:0
  • value  10724
    address  32HZ7x1vBUXNMKtDP7Xat3zph37CdvhsZS
  • 67650d51a73164a5d4314da262f6a3fe40b9f1d50cc92a34bb1eacab9b9bb15d:1
  • value  28593818
    address  1DC9XWDvJnwJwdqUBKHq1U3KFvC7E1rRxZ